Project Description
What if you could use your engineering skills to develop a solution that impacts the way communities hospitals, homes, sports stadiums, and schools across the world are built? Construction impacts the lives of nearly everyone in the world, and yet it’s also one of the world's least digitized industries, not to mention one of the most dangerous. That’s why we're looking for a talented Senior Compliance Engineer to join the journey with our client Procore. As a Compliance Engineer, you’ll be a key member of the GRC team, within our Security Engineering Department. You’ll partner cross-functionally with our Platform, Applications, Infrastructure, IT Security, Compliance, Product, Legal, and Internal Audit teams to develop and maintain compliance with existing control standards, as well as pursue new ones.

Responsibilities
Maintain a risk & control matrix for Product & Technology
Facilitate audits for any existing or future control standard that Procore currently holds or plans to pursue
Collect and manage audit evidence
Understand the control stack, including mitigating controls
Keep up with changing standards and evaluate any necessary updates to our control set
Analyze overlap between control standards to estimate level of effort necessary to achieve certification against a new standard
Keep data in the GRC platform current and relevant
Work closely with IT Compliance, Internal Audit, Legal, and Product to develop, maintain, and improve our compliance posture

About Zoolatech

Zoolatech is a boutique service provider, specializing in high-end software development. We are based in Silicon Valley with a Development Center in Kyiv, Ukraine. Although ZoolaTech is a relatively young player on the Eastern European market, we have deep roots and years of experience of working within Ukrainian and American high tech industries. The size of our clientele varies from Fortune 500 to inspiring startups. We are not an outsourcer in a traditional sense, rather we specialize in helping our Clients scale by extending their teams to Eastern Europe.
